Red wigglers and compost worms' favored foods are most fruits - they specifically like bananas, strawberries, raspberries, blueberries, peaches, and melons! Yes - yet we suggest feeding potato peels to worms in small amounts (Worm Farms United States). Potato peels are starchy and don't damage down easily so they can take a while for the red wigglers to failure and take inWe feed our worms at Brothers Worm Ranch two times a week, and the majority of us do the exact same with our worm containers in your home. Red wigglers tend to consume even more when temperature levels are moderate (60-80 degrees), so you may discover a need to feed them more during these periods. If you are leaving for vacation or a journey and are stressed over your worms, there are a couple of things you can do to ensure their survival.
Just comply with these actions and your wiggly friends ought to be great while you're gone: Mix in fresh bedding to the container. Bedding can be the original kind of bed linens you used or a number of handfuls of shredded cardboard. Give the surface of the bed linens a heavy misting so the bed linen does not completely dry out.

Place a piece of cardboard over the surface area of the bin (this will certainly aid it keep wetness). If you are leaving for greater than 2 weeks, we recommend having a friend or member of the family feed and water the worms every 1.5 weeks while you are gone. You can leave food for the worms in the fridge and a little spray bottle for watering.

Red worms are nature's utmost composting worm and a terrific pick for worm ranches. They're frequently called red wigglers, tiger worms, manure worms, composting worms, and the trout worms.

Red worms have numerous properties which make them ideal for the garden compost bin. Of all the worms suitable for worm farming the red worm is the most adaptable and hearty.
Rotting leaves, grasses, wood, and pet manure are all favorites of red worms. The red worm's starved appetite makes it the champ of the compost container and an online worm casting (a.k.a. worm poop) machines. Red worms are relatively small, typically getting no bigger than 5 inches. Don't ignore them.
A 24" x 24" worm container can easily house over 1000 red worms. For those interested in raising bait worms it's excellent to keep in mind that jampacked red worms will stay rather skinny and brief.

An additional advantage of red worms is their capacity with stand a wide variety of temperature level extremes. Normally red wigglers prosper in temperatures in between 65F and 80F (18 C 27 C). When the temperature dips red worms need to be safeguarded from freezing weather condition. Even red worms kept outside can quickly make it through the cold temperature levels of north The United States and copyright. Worm Farms Near Me.
That can be as simple as maintaining them in trench loaded with aged manure and covered with straw or leaves. ; when temperatures surge keep your worm ranch cool. If your bed linen overcomes 85 levels red worms will attempt to escape your containers for cooler locations. So supply them with shade or preferably relocation them into your cellar.
If you don't feed them they will go trying to find food. Like all worms red worms breathe oxygen with their skin. In order to breathe they require a wet, but not saturated bedding product. A moist environment likewise facilitates the failure of natural matter in their bed linens product by microbial life kinds.
